Remebering Noble...

Noble Group was one of my first few purchases from the open market.  Actually I do not remember now the reason why I bought Noble.  Perhaps some hot tips?  But during the days of the 1,000 shares per lot time, Noble was the first counter that I held more than a single lot size.

When I decided to embark on my dividend investment journey, Noble was the first counter that got the cut because of its low dividend payouts.  I exited Noble with some profits when it was still a low $2+ stock.

Not that I am paying particular attention to the stocks that I have in the past, but Noble was always in the news.  Muddy Waters, Iceberg reports and the non-stop procession of bad news keep Noble in the forefront of financial news.

Now the CEO had left and the Chairman is abandoning ship.  And the issue of 1:1 rights at massive discount to the current share price.  This is a sad story of a commodity giant turning into a penny stock.

Well, you win some and you lose some.  I also cut off Raffles Medical which is turning into a big mistake now.....
